Manuel Antonio National Park, Province of Puntarenas, Costa Rica kkakashWe finally made it to Manuel Antonio park for the first time on this trip. We walked through the park, wondering why we hadn't come earlier, looking at sloths, monkeys and Iguana. We saw 2 and 3-toed sloths high in trees, lots of Iguanas of all sizes, a Jesus Christ lizard, hermit crabs and white-faced monkeys putting on a show for the tourists.
